Valle Del Cielo Grazia Montepulciano D’abruzzo 2016
Fresh vintages coming out this month
This new winery from Abruzzo has just landed on our shores and comprises Montepulciano and Sangiovese for reds, and Trebbiano, Pecorino and Passerina for whites. Supervised by veteran winemaker Corrado de Angelis Corvi and produced using organic and biodynamic methods, the wine undergoes natural wild ferment, giving it a rich integrity and naturally subtle depths of blackberries, cedar spices and tea leaves. The winery’s name translates as valley in the sky, but it is also the Adriatic coast terroir that gives it elevation, sea breezes and a particular spirit. $60 from Wine Clique
Can you pair Chilean wines with fine and casual cuisine alike? That’s the question Marques de Casa Concha is setting out to answer with the second edition of Marques Perfect Match. Twelve restaurants, including Salt Grill & Sky Bar, Ristorante Luka, Mitzo and Whitegrass, have taken up the challenge. At the latter, chef Takuya Yamashita has carefully chosen ingredients such as seasonal flying fish and Hokkaido crab with sweet corn to pair with the surprisingly delicate and mineral-inflected Marques de Casa Concha Chardonnay. Surprisingly, the seasonal fish with its rich saffron, sancho butter and mussel broth goes equally well with the cool climate Pinot Noir which showed restrained, fresh raspberry and a touch of herbs.
$168 (five courses), $228 (eight courses), $44 for two paired wines. At respective restaurants till end of October.
